Fobs Not Working

It may seem odd to imagine that your key fob could require routine maintenance, however it's not unusual to see them stop working at some time. Sometimes, the issue can be as simple as a dead battery. If you've changed the batteries and your fob still doesn't work, it may be an opportunity to try something else.

The buttons may also wear out, which is another common reason why a keypad stops functioning. When you press the button on your fob, the contacts send a coded message to the receiver inside your car which communicates what action you would like the key to perform. If the contacts on the fob's key are damaged or damaged, you might not be able to press the button or transmit a different message than what you expected.

You can fix this problem quickly by using a physical car key to unlock your doors or start your engine. You can reset your fob by following instructions in the owner's manual for your vehicle (check online for specific instructions).

If changing the batteries and reprogramming the key fob don't help you, you may need to replace it or have it repaired. Modern keys have to be programmed using your car's Vehicle Identification Number. Errors or wear and tear could cause damage to this program.

Transponder Chips

The transponder chip on your car keys is a very vital component of the key. The transponder chips inside your car key are a very crucial component of your car key. They transmit an electronic signal with a specific frequency, each time the key is put in the ignition. The device inside the vehicle then detects the code to know it's you. The engine won't begin when the device in the car isn't able to recognize the signal, which is intended as a security measure to stop thieves from wiring cars and stealing them.

The chip is not an battery, therefore it does not require charging or replaced. It needs to be programmed by someone who has access to the ECU of your vehicle. This is why you should make sure you take your keys to an expert locksmith.

There are a variety of transponder chip available on the market, with the most popular are Rolling Code and Crypto.
